Printhead assembly with an ink supply arrangement having printhead segment carriers
View Patent ↗A printhead assembly which includes an ink supply arrangement having a profile member defining a semi-open cross-section with peripheral, structured side walls having free, opposing, lengthwise running edges delineating a gap extending along the entire length of the profile member, said profile member defining three internal webs that stand out from a base wall section of the peripheral wall into the interior of said member so as to define together with the side wall sections ink supply channels which are open towards the gap. The assembly also includes a plurality of printhead segment carriers operatively fast with the ink supply arrangement so that the ink supply channels are arranged in fluid communication with a printhead operatively supported on said segments. Also included is a shield plate supported by the profile member, said plate for protecting the printhead during printing.
